Today’s racing is over, and I will let Brad write about his time on the race course. Today, I was still juggling work and wanting to watch the racing. So I worked in the internet area that is set up in the club house until early afternoon, then drove to the other side of St. Margaret’ s Bay, to watch... and do laundry. It seems that Brad didn’t bring enough shirts to get him through without having the laundry done. Lucky for Brad, the laundromat is one of the viewing spots I found the other day.

After the laundry was done, I drove to another location, which was better for viewing. With binoculars, I was able to see the boats, but really could not take in much about the actual racing.

I have heard that the race committee has already decided to cancel the Sunday racing because of Hurricane Bill. This has not been officially announced yet, but I think that it will happen tomorrow. It seems that all the lasers will be stacked into the club house and other areas for protection from Bill. All the sailors are expected to help in the stacking operation, even though these are not their own boats. That will be something to see.
